Summary/Abstract: This paper is meant to show how the e-training is used in the mathematical e-modeling of the kinematic and dynamic characteristics for improving the execution technique of the clean and jerk style in performance weightlifting. This scientific approach led to the organization of an ascertaining experimental study carried out during the European Weightlifting Championships for Juniors Bucharest, 2011, with a group of 7 athletes, finalists in 56 kg category. The following research methods were used in this study: bibliographic review of the specialized scientific literature, video computerized method using the capture and video processing program named „Pinnacle Studio” and the specialized programs for biomechanical analysis of sports technique - „Kinovea” and „Physics ToolKit”. In order to highlight the biomechanical characteristics of the key elements in clean & jerk style technique, the biomechanical analysis was made in two parts: a) start, straightening, flipping, dip, lifting – moment of concentration; b) split jerk, the drive and the overhead barbell locking. A number of 19 attempts were analyzed from biomechanical point of view; afterwards, the results of the kinematic and dynamic characteristics and the performances achieved in competition were correlated in terms of statistics. The results of the research show the linear correlation significance of the indicators of the translational movement biomechanical features in accordance with the anthropometrical, biomechanical and performance parameters of junior weightlifters in order to elaborate the mathematical model of the clean & jerk style in performance weightlifting. The efficient use of e-training in the mathematical modeling of the biomechanical characteristics and sports performances of junior weightlifters created the possibility to further address the sports technique of the clean & jerk style and the more effective processing of the modern didactical programs meant to improve it.
